A high-performance industrial component, this 304 stainless steel stock sheet measures 0.039 inches in thickness, 31 inches in width, and 41 inches in length. Fabricated from AISI 304 austenitic stainless steel, it exhibits excellent resistance to a wide range of corrosive media, making it ideal for applications exposed to moisture, chemicals, or varying atmospheric conditions. The material's inherent toughness and ductility allow for precise bending, cutting, and shaping without compromising structural integrity. This makes it a preferred choice for creating custom brackets, hangers, supports, and other bracing elements where longevity and reliability are paramount.

| ❌ Mistake | ✅ Correct Approach |
|---|---|
| Using standard carbon steel cutting tools without proper cleaning, leading to rust spots. | Utilize dedicated stainless steel cutting tools and ensure thorough cleaning of the sheet and tools before and after cutting. |
| Overworking the material during bending, causing work hardening and potential cracking. | Employ gradual bending techniques and observe proper bend radii for 0.039" thick 304 stainless steel to prevent premature failure. |
